Value for a 1968 Firebird 400 H.O.

Short answer: $17,000+ was considered high for any non-Ram-Air 400 H.O. coupe, even a strong #2 car. The 1968 400 H.O. (and 1969 400 H.O./RA III) bring only modest premiums over a standard 400 — the H.O. added Long Branch manifolds and the 068 performance cam/carb (4-speed only), so the auto H.O. cars are close to a standard 400.

The real money is in the Ram Air cars (1967 RA I, 1968 RA I/II, 1969 RA IV) — functional induction, radical cams, high-flow heads, bulletproof 3.90 posi rears, and their own carbs (the 1969 400 RA III had functional induction but no special heads or 3.90, <100 made). Convertibles also command big premiums.

One member’s price ranges for a solid driver (high-3 / low-2 condition) — note these are from ~2000; “?” = guesswork, and today’s values are much higher:

1967 400 (est., ~2000)
Variant Est.
400 coupe auto $6,500
400 coupe 4-speed $8,000
400 coupe RA I auto $15,500 ?
400 coupe RA I 4-spd $17,500 ?
400 conv auto $11,000
400 conv 4-speed $13,500
400 conv RA I auto $40,000–60,000 ?? (only 2 built)
400 conv RA I 4-spd $40,000–60,000 ?? (only 6 built)
1968 400 (est., ~2000)
Variant Est.
400 coupe auto $6,500
400 coupe 4-speed $8,000
400 coupe H.O. auto $8,500 (high-2 car maybe +30%)
400 coupe H.O. 4-speed $11,000
400 coupe RA I auto $14,000 ?
400 coupe RA I 4-spd $17,500 ?
400 coupe RA II auto $35,000–50,000 ??
400 coupe RA II 4-spd $40,000–60,000 ??
400 conv auto $11,000
400 conv 4-speed $13,500
400 conv H.O. auto $13,500
400 conv H.O. 4-speed $17,000
400 conv RA I auto $30,000–35,000 ??
400 conv RA I 4-spd $40,000–60,000 ??
400 conv RA II auto $50,000–75,000 ??
400 conv RA II 4-spd $55,000–85,000 ??
All figures are from roughly 2000 and are well out of date — use current auction results and price guides. The 1968 RA I auto cars used the downgraded 068 cam, which softens their value somewhat.
